WMJobs is seeking a Head of Physical Education at Hagley Catholic High School, part of Emmaus Catholic Multi Academy Company. This full-time, permanent role starts on January 1, 2027, or earlier.

The ideal candidate will have extensive experience in teaching Physical Education at Key Stages 3-5 and must uphold the Catholic ethos. Responsibilities include supporting the department's ethos and leading extracurricular programs.

Applicants must provide documentation to prove their right to work in the UK.
